Скрыть открытые ярлыки на рабочем столе без административных привилегий

Я просмотрел множество вопросов, связанных с иконками рабочего стола в Windows 7, но я еще не нашел ответ, который я ищу.

Цель состоит в том, чтобы значки рабочего стола в общей папке, чтобы все пользователи видели их по умолчанию. Однако, если пользователь хочет скрыть все ярлыки из Public Desktop, он должен уметь.

  • Обои в двух мониторах с разным разрешением
  • Почему у меня есть два файла desktop.ini на рабочем столе Windows 8?
  • Как заставить монитор пойти прямо на черное на сцене?
  • Больше нет значков на рабочем столе Windows 7
  • Почему мои значки ярлыков разбиваются на Windows 7?
  • Внешний вид значков Windows 10 изменен
  • В последней части я не нашел пути. Пока это похоже на ситуацию «все или ничего». Либо у вас есть ярлыки для каждого пользователя, либо их в папке «Публикация / Рабочий стол» заставляет всех иметь их видимыми, не имея возможности сами изменить это.

    В основном я хочу, чтобы пользователи могли отключить интеграцию между своим Desktop и Public, эффективно просматривая только то, что у них есть в папке C:\Users\<User>\Desktop .

    Изменить : сосредоточиться на возможности отключить интеграцию пользовательского и общедоступного рабочего стола.

  • Что произойдет, если мы уменьшим размер hiberfil.sys
  • Не удается удалить папку в Windows 7
  • Дополнительная папка Program Files в Win7 и ее удаление
  • Проблемы с мышью (щелчок) в Windows 7
  • Включить / отключить параметр «Показать скрытые файлы» из командной строки
  • Почему я не могу сделать символическую ссылку (mklink), даже когда я являюсь администратором
  • 3 Solutions collect form web for “Скрыть открытые ярлыки на рабочем столе без административных привилегий”

    Учитывая тот факт, что это общедоступная папка, доступная для всех, любые изменения одного пользователя будут отражаться на всех компьютерах.

    Единственный способ сохранить то, что вы хотите сделать, – это то, что вы предложили; Для каждого пользователя.

    Да, ты можешь. В правой учетной записи администратора щелкните по общедоступному каталогу рабочего стола, безопасности, выберите пользователя (добавьте, если не отобразить), отредактируйте разрешения, например, запретите все права. Я объясню больше, если найду больше времени.

    Да, вы можете получить правильный ответ. Просто нужно было сделать это сам, и это довольно просто, если вы подумаете об этом. Поскольку у меня есть несколько более крупный сценарий, чем один сервер терминалов, я создал страницу ASP с gridview для управления пользователями (где они могут самостоятельно управлять интеграцией значков). Пользователи загружаются из AD в SQL в таблицу с помощью (ID, ADUSER, WantsIcons). Что касается меня, это asp, тогда я запускаю код C # в конце (можно сделать с помощью скрипта, вот несколько указателей: https://technet.microsoft.com/en-us/magazine/2008.02.powershell.aspx ) ,

    К моменту: вам нужна какая-то среда, в которой вы можете передать административное право пользователя – например, в очень простой среде, для этого вы можете использовать планировщик задач – вы создаете задачу с правами администратора по папке «Общий рабочий стол». Теперь вы добавляете пользователю право запускать эту задачу. Затем эта задача (или, в моем случае, C # за страницей asp) изменит права пользователя по каждому ярлыку в папке «C: \ users \ Public Desktop». Если бы вы использовали веб-страницу, такую ​​как я, вы могли бы сделать ее на значок.

    Давайте будем гением компьютера.